The Temperature Monitoring System Market was valued at USD 3.81 billion in 2024 and is projected to grow to USD 4.04 billion in 2025, with a CAGR of 6.19%, reaching USD 5.46 billion by 2030.
KEY MARKET STATISTICS | |
---|---|
Base Year [2024] | USD 3.81 billion |
Estimated Year [2025] | USD 4.04 billion |
Forecast Year [2030] | USD 5.46 billion |
CAGR (%) | 6.19% |

Regional Insights: Global Market Dynamics Across Key Regions
Key Regional Insights
Globally, the market for temperature monitoring systems exhibits varied dynamics across different regions. In the Americas, the drive towards modern infrastructure and stringent regulatory standards has accelerated the adoption of advanced monitoring systems. The region shows rapid customer acceptance of both traditional and digital innovations as organizations seek to minimize risks while optimizing operational efficiencies.
Across Europe, the Middle East and Africa, a blend of high-standard industrial practices and the need for robust solutions in extreme environments contributes to market growth. Regulatory frameworks and the demand for energy-efficient solutions stimulate continuous advancements, as companies invest in systems that ensure precise control of temperature-sensitive environments. Lastly, the Asia-Pacific region stands out with its massive industrial base and growing technology adaptation, where thriving manufacturing sectors, coupled with expanding healthcare and research institutions, have driven the need for sophisticated temperature monitoring systems. This regional diversity underscores the importance of localized strategies to capture market share and address varying consumer needs.
